Overview

LTC2140IUP-14#PBF from Analog Devices (formerly Linear Technology) is a 14-bit, 25Msps dual-channel simultaneous-sampling analog-to-digital converter optimized for high-dynamic-range signal acquisition in demanding RF and instrumentation systems. It delivers 72.7dB SNR, 90dB SFDR, and ultralow 0.10psRMS jitter at 70MHz input, operating from a single 1.8V supply with 50mW total power consumption - ideal for portable medical imaging and multi-channel data acquisition.

Technical Context

The LTC2140IUP-14#PBF implements two independent 14-bit ADC cores sharing a common sample-and-hold with 750MHz bandwidth and 0.10psRMS aperture jitter in differential encode mode. Its architecture supports simultaneous sampling across both channels with <±1.5mV offset matching and ±0.2%FS gain matching - critical for phase-coherent I/Q demodulation in SDR and base station receivers.

Digital interface flexibility includes full-rate CMOS, DDR CMOS, or DDR LVDS output modes, with separate OVDD supply enabling 1.2V–1.8V CMOS swing control. Configuration is managed via SPI-compatible serial port (CS/SCK/SDI/SDO) or parallel logic inputs, supporting shutdown and nap modes for dynamic power management.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
Resolution14-bit with no missing codes over –40°C to +85°C - ensures monotonicity in closed-loop control and precision measurement.
Sampling Rate25Msps - enables Nyquist-limited capture of signals up to 12.5MHz without aliasing in baseband applications.
SNR @ 70MHz72.7dBFS - provides >12 effective bits for high-fidelity digitization of IF signals in communications receivers.
SFDR @ 70MHz90dBc - suppresses spurious content sufficiently for LTE/WiMAX adjacent channel rejection requirements.
Total Power50mW at 25Msps with CMOS outputs - allows thermal-constrained deployment in handheld ultrasound and portable test equipment.
Input Bandwidth750MHz full-power - supports undersampling of 2nd/3rd Nyquist zone signals up to 375MHz with minimal amplitude roll-off.
Aperture Jitter0.10psRMS (differential encode) - limits SNR degradation to <0.1dB at 140MHz input frequency.

Pinout & Package

64-lead (9mm × 9mm) plastic QFN package with exposed thermal pad (Pin 65 = GND), requiring soldering to PCB ground plane for thermal and electrical integrity. Pin functions are identical across all digital output modes (CMOS/LVDS).

Pin/TerminalCircuit RoleDesign Meaning
VDD (1,16,17,64)Analog supply input1.7–1.9V rail powering ADC core and reference; requires local 0.1μF ceramic bypass per group.
AIN1+/AIN1– (4,5)Differential analog input CH1Accepts 1–2VP-P input range; biased by VCM1 (Pin 2) at VDD/2 for optimal common-mode rejection.
ENC+/ENC– (18,19)Differential encode clock inputRising/falling edge-triggered sampling; ENC– tied to GND enables single-ended operation.
PAR/SER (11)Programming mode selectGround = serial SPI mode; VDD = parallel logic mode - determines CS/SCK/SDI function mapping.
D1_0–D1_13 / D2_0–D2_13 (25–32,45–58, etc.)Parallel data outputs14-bit CMOS outputs per channel; pin grouping varies by output mode (full-rate, DDR, or LVDS differential pairs).
OVDD (42)Digital output supply1.1–1.9V adjustable rail setting CMOS output swing or LVDS current mode (1.75/3.5mA).
SENSE (63)Reference configurationConnect to VDD for ±1V input range; to GND for ±0.5V; or to external 0.625–1.3V reference for custom scaling.

Key Features

FeatureDesign Value
Simultaneous sampling dual ADCGuaranteed <1ps inter-channel skew enables coherent I/Q sampling without calibration overhead.
Configurable output interfaceHardware-selectable CMOS/DDR CMOS/DDR LVDS eliminates need for external level translators in FPGA interfacing.
Internal reference with external option1.25V ±25ppm/°C VREF output and SENSE-pin programmable input range reduce BOM count and layout complexity.
Low-power sleep/nap modes1mW sleep and 10mW nap modes allow rapid wake-up (<1μs) for burst-mode acquisition in battery-powered instruments.
Serial SPI configuration portFull register access via 4-wire interface enables runtime reconfiguration of output format, randomizer, and clock stabilizer.

FAQ

What is the maximum input frequency supported by the LTC2140IUP-14#PBF?

The LTC2140IUP-14#PBF features a 750MHz full-power bandwidth, meaning it can accurately digitize analog inputs up to 750MHz without significant amplitude attenuation. This enables undersampling applications where IF signals in the second or third Nyquist zone (e.g., 140MHz at 25Msps) are captured directly, reducing front-end filtering complexity in SDR and test equipment designs using the LTC2140IUP-14#PBF.

Does the LTC2140IUP-14#PBF support both differential and single-ended clock inputs?

Yes, the LTC2140IUP-14#PBF supports both configurations via the ENC+ and ENC– pins. In differential mode, a 2VP-P sine wave applied across ENC+/ENC– achieves 0.10psRMS jitter. In single-ended mode, ENC– is tied to GND and ENC+ accepts TTL, CMOS, or PECL-compatible signals - enabling flexible clock tree integration without external differential receivers in the LTC2140IUP-14#PBF design.

How does the SENSE pin affect the input range of the LTC2140IUP-14#PBF?

The SENSE pin on the LTC2140IUP-14#PBF selects the full-scale input range: connecting SENSE to VDD configures ±1V (2VP-P), tying it to GND sets ±0.5V (1VP-P), and applying an external 0.625–1.3V reference enables custom scaling. This hardware-selectable range eliminates firmware configuration overhead and ensures deterministic analog performance across temperature - a key feature distinguishing the LTC2140IUP-14#PBF from fixed-range alternatives.

What output interface options does the LTC2140IUP-14#PBF provide?

The LTC2140IUP-14#PBF supports three parallel output modes: full-rate CMOS, double-data-rate (DDR) CMOS, and DDR LVDS - selected via SCK in parallel programming mode or SPI register in serial mode. CMOS outputs operate from 1.2–1.8V OVDD for FPGA compatibility, while DDR LVDS provides noise-immune transmission at 3.5mA or 1.75mA current levels - giving designers interface flexibility without external translators in the LTC2140IUP-14#PBF implementation.

Is the LTC2140IUP-14#PBF pin-compatible with other members of the LTC214x family?

Yes, the LTC2140IUP-14#PBF shares identical 64-pin QFN packaging, pinout, and footprint with LTC2141IUP-14#PBF (40Msps) and LTC2142IUP-14#PBF (65Msps). This allows drop-in speed upgrades within the same PCB layout - for example, replacing LTC2140IUP-14#PBF with LTC2141IUP-14#PBF increases sampling rate to 40Msps while retaining all analog and digital connections, simplifying design scalability in the LTC2140IUP-14#PBF platform.
